<p>Happy 4th of July to everyone. This time next week, all the eyes of amateur basketball will be affixed in Louisville for Run for the Roses. I can't tell you how excited I am for the event. This event is the premier showcase event where young ladies can truly make a name for themselves amongst the recruiting ranks. Kids walk away with opportunities coming from this tournament. There isn't a better way to kickstart your recruitment than to play in this tournament.</p>

<p class="text-gray-700">This sophomore-to-be has received an offer from UTC, and that will not be her last. This girl is a smooth criminal and just plays the game the right way. She has a bag over moves that enable her to get to favor spots on the floor. She can dial it up from deep or maneuver her way to the rim. She plays D, getting steals and deflections. This kid is tough and she has been having a solid year on the EYBL circuit. Cleveland may have graduated a star athlete, but they have another one in the making in this young lady.<br><br></p>

<p class="text-gray-700">I rave about this young lady because her game has evolved over the years. She went from a back-to-the-basket kid to someone who can handle the rock and break you down using her handles. She can stretch the floor out, knock down 3s, pull up jumpers, or just utilize her size to get through contact on her way to the rim. I love her ability to block shots, control the boards, and clog the lane. She's a threat on both ends of the floor, and schools are taking notice now of how much of an asset she is becoming. Look for her to walk away with even more opportunities to compete at the next level.<br><br></p>
